Re: [open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-08 Thread Mario Villaplana
We want to deprecate ironic CLI soon, but I would prefer if that were discussed on a separate thread if possible, aside from concerns about versioning in ironic CLI. Feature parity should exist in Pike, then we can issue a warning in Queens and deprecate the cycle after. More information is on

Re: [open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-08 Thread Dmitry Tantsur
On 03/07/2017 04:59 PM, Loo, Ruby wrote: On 2017-03-06, 3:46 PM, "Mario Villaplana" wrote: Hi ironic, At the PTG, an issue regarding the default version of the ironic API used in our python-openstackclient plugin was discussed. [0] In short, the

Re: [open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-07 Thread Loo, Ruby
On 2017-03-06, 3:46 PM, "Mario Villaplana" wrote: Hi ironic, At the PTG, an issue regarding the default version of the ironic API used in our python-openstackclient plugin was discussed. [0] In short, the issue is that we default to a very old API

Re: [open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-07 Thread Miles Gould
On 07/03/17 12:14, Jim Rollenhagen wrote: I'm also good with the standard deprecation period for this. +1 to "standard deprecation period" - sorry, I'd misremembered what that was. Miles __ OpenStack Development

Re: [open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-07 Thread Jim Rollenhagen
On Tue, Mar 7, 2017 at 6:36 AM, Dmitry Tantsur wrote: > On 03/07/2017 12:32 PM, Miles Gould wrote: > >> On 06/03/17 20:46, Mario Villaplana wrote: >> >>> We also still have yet to decide what a suitable deprecation period is >>> for this change, as far as I'm aware. Please

Re: [open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-07 Thread Dmitry Tantsur
On 03/07/2017 12:32 PM, Miles Gould wrote: On 06/03/17 20:46, Mario Villaplana wrote: We also still have yet to decide what a suitable deprecation period is for this change, as far as I'm aware. Please respond to this email with any suggestions on the deprecation period. One cycle? I'd go

Re: [open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-07 Thread Miles Gould
On 06/03/17 20:46, Mario Villaplana wrote: We also still have yet to decide what a suitable deprecation period is for this change, as far as I'm aware. Please respond to this email with any suggestions on the deprecation period. One cycle? Miles

[openstack-dev] [ironic] OpenStack client default ironic API version

2017-03-06 Thread Mario Villaplana
Hi ironic, At the PTG, an issue regarding the default version of the ironic API used in our python-openstackclient plugin was discussed. [0] In short, the issue is that we default to a very old API version when the user doesn't otherwise specify it. This limits discoverability of new features and